Mera Peak - 9 October to 3 November 2003

Written by Leader, November 2003

An enjoyable, but alas ultimately summit-free expedition. After walking in the long way and acclimatising well, at the crucial moment of our move up to base camp the heavens opened, dumping dangerous quantities of snow on the mountain. A fruitless wait at the Mera La for conditions to improve was followed by a difficult and demanding return to the valley. We returned to Lukla the quick way, over the Zatrwa La, which gave the opportunity for some of the team to visit Namche Bazaar and the Khumbu valley, with superb views of Everest. When then flew back to Kathmandu to catch the sights before heading home.
